Chimneys - Design, installation and commissioning - Part 2: Chimneys and connecting flue pipes for room sealed combustion appliances

This document describes the method of specifying the design, installation and labelling criteria for chimney systems, construction of custom-built chimneys, the relining or converting of existing chimneys, connecting flue pipes and air supply pipes for room sealed combustion appliances as well as the use of chimney products. It also gives information on commissioning of an installed chimney.
This document applies to chimneys which are subject to the following limiting conditions:
-   the distance between the supports not to exceed 4 m;
-   the distance above the last structural attachment not to exceed 3 m;
-   the free-standing height above the uppermost structural support attachment for chimneys with rectangular cross section is not more than five times the smallest external dimension.
This document does not cover:
-   chimneys which serve a mixture of fan assisted or forced draught burners or natural draught appliances,
-   installations having a configuration of the type C2.
NOTE   Room sealed gas appliances are classified as type C according to EN 1749.
The methods in this part of this document are applicable to chimneys and connecting flue pipes for room sealed combustion appliances. The methods in Part 1 of this document are applicable to chimneys and connecting flue pipes for non-room sealed combustion appliances.

European foreword

This document (prEN 15287-2:2021) has been prepared by Technical Committee CEN/TC 166

“Chimneys”, the secretariat of which is held by ASI.
This document is currently submitted to the CEN Enquiry.
This document will supersede EN 15287-2:2008.

This European Standard is part of the series of standards Chimneys — Design, installation and commissioning:

— Part 1: Chimneys and connecting flue pipes for non-room sealed combustion appliances.

— Part 2: Chimneys and connecting flue pipes for room sealed and connecting flue pipes appliances.

Currently the standard series EN 1856, Chimneys — Requirements for metal chimneys, is also under

revision and if accepted, modifications to the normative text will be have to be made regarding metal

chimneys.

In comparison with the previous edition, the following technical modifications have been made:

a) restructuring of the chapters and annexes;
b) harmonization of the text with part 1;
c) updating the content according to EN 1443:2019;
d) adoption of all relevant terms from EN 1443:2019 and prEN 15287-1;
e) adoption of all relevant chapters and annexes from prEN 15287-1;

f) description of the designation and classes of a chimney according to EN 1443:2019;

g) expanding the specifications for accessories;
h) schematic illustrations of examples of installation configurations;
i) recommendations for some minimum distances from combustible material given;

j) scope was extended to include positive pressure chimneys of pressure class “H” and multiserved

chimneys of the pressure class “P”.

Introduction

CEN/TC 166 started with its programme on standardization of chimneys approximately 30 years ago,

with standards for interfaces, for products, for tests and last but not least for design, installation,

construction and commissioning matters.

In the last years, first priority in the work program was given to product and test standards.

In the meantime most of the product and test standards were published or are nearly ready for

publication. In order to introduce the products in a simple way on the markets of the different Member

States, some common rules for design, installation, and commissioning especially with reference to the

designation of a chimney were considered helpful.

Initially, CEN/TC 166/SC 2 started the work on execution standards for metal chimneys, the first

standard already been published as EN 12391-1 in 2003.

In order not to repeat this work in all material orientated WGs and SCs, CEN/TC 166 decided in 2002 to

give the task to WG 1 to develop a material independent design, installation and commissioning

standard.

CEN/TC 166/WG 1 started the work in 2003 and decided first to draft two documents, one for

chimneys connected to non-room sealed combustion appliances and one for chimneys connected to

room sealed combustion appliances.
